Pelling, Sikkim

The scenic beauty of Pelling in West Sikkim can be cited as a high potential destination that provides tourists with a sense of untouched beauty along with the impact of a strong culture. The destination is becoming popular among many tourists as it provides a sense of getting a closer look at one of the majestic views of Mt. Kanchenjunga along with other parts of the Himalayas. The tourist can also get access to popular tourist spots like Pemayangtse Monastery and Khecheopalri Lake. To one’s delight, the region has a diverse offering of activities, and also allows one to walk on India’s first glass skywalk bridge. Pelling’s serene environment and enthralling natural background fits perfect for nature walks and small treks, bring the tourist and locals a notch closer.
